Time Out.  —  “You love the Red Sox, but have they ever loved you back?”  —  The New York Yankees had a 10-game losing streak once.  It was in 1913.  —  The Los Angeles Dodgers had a 10-game losing streak in 1992.  That's their only double-digit losing streak since they moved into Dodger Stadium - in 1962, 50 years ago.

Evaluating the Royals  —  The Kansas City Royals have lost 11 consecutive games, and at 3-13, they have the worst record in baseball.  Even their most ardent supporters are walking away.  Whatever optimism their farm system had generated before the season began has been washed away in a sea of losses …

Dontrelle Willis filing grievance  —  Pitcher Dontrelle Willis is filing a grievance against the Baltimore Orioles, alleging that the club placed him on the restricted list and is preventing him from signing with another organization even though he left the Orioles' Triple-A affiliate with the consent of a team official.

Narveson to have season-ending surgery  —  Chris Narveson just told reporters that the second opinion on his left shoulder was the same as the first — he needs season-ending surgery to repair a partially torn rotator cuff.  Dr. Lewis Yocum will perform the surgery, which will require a 6-9 month rehab, Narveson said.

Michael Pineda to get 2nd opinion  —  ARLINGTON, Texas — New York Yankees pitcher Michael Pineda was examined by team physicians after undergoing an MRI on his shoulder Tuesday in New York, but the team did not announce the results because the pitcher's agent requested he get a second opinion on Wednesday.

Mets place Jason Bay on 15-day DL with fractured rib  —  The Mets have placed Jason Bay on the 15-Day DL with a nondisplaced fracture of a rib on the left side.  —  To take Bay's place on the roster, the Mets recalled infielder Zach Lutz from Triple-A Buffalo.
